School Safety Programme Conducted by NDRF

On May 17, 2025, the 15th Battalion of the National Disaster Response Force (NDRF), Gadarpur, Uttarakhand ,organized a comprehensive school safety program at Raja Rammohan Roy Academy under the supervision of Inspector Laxman Thapliyal. The program aimed to enhance the school's preparedness for emergencies and disasters.

The program included informative lectures and presentations on school safety measures to be  taken before, during, and after a disaster. Students also participated in hands-on training sessions on medical first aid, including CPR, bleeding control, drowning, choking, and carrying methods. Additionally, they learned how to build improvised stretchers.

The primary objective of the program was to spread awareness, build preparedness, courage, and confidence among students, and enhance their ability to respond quickly and effectively during emergencies. Through this initiative, the NDRF team empowered the students and faculty of Raja Rammohan Roy Academy with essential skills and knowledge to ensure a safer school community.
